串口下载软件选用的是FlyMcu或MCUISP,通过串口的DTR和RTS信号来自动配置BOOT0和RESET信号,不需要用户手动切换它们的状态,直接串口软件自动控制,可以方便的下载代码。 我们需要注意一点:CH340G上电后DTR#和RTS#都为高电平,在用MCUISP烧写软件时,我们在软件下方选择“DTR的低电平复位,RTS高电平进BootLoader”,CH340G I...
1.硬件的连接和设置 串口ISP下载方式(对应开发板BOOT0为1、2引脚,BOOT1为2、3引脚) STM32下载程序的方法,与51单片机差不多,一般有三种方法:MDK编译器附带的烧写、串口ISP烧写、J-FLASH 方式烧写。 当然,不同的下载方式对应STM32启动方式也不同,如下图是STM32三种启动方式: ● 第一种启动方式是最常用的 用户...
四、 下载 1、配置好BOOT Boot0 接到 3.3V 上, Boot1 接到 GND,对板子 重新上电, STM32 单片机重启的时候,会进入到 ISP 模式,接线是USB转TTL对最小系统板 5V-5V TX-PA10 RX-PA9 GND-GND 在这里插入图片描述 2、选对应串口,一般点搜索串口就会自动识别, 在这里插入图片描述 3、波特率默认就好 请...
1.1将stm32的启动模式设置为系统存储器启动模式(即串口下载模式/ISP下载模式) 具体:在stm32上将上电之前要先设置BOOT0=1,BOOT1=0,然后才能通过串口下载程序 补充:详细可以查看网址:如何使用串口来给STM32下载程序 - whik - 博客园 stm32启动模式说明: STM32的启动模式,共有下列三种,可以通过BOOT0和BOOT1电平...
http://www.mcuisp.com/ 当然,用我提供的也行,反正也是他们官网下载的。 下载好后解压,双击 .exe 文件即可打开,无需安装。 2.3 硬件连线 在下载程序之前,请先接好线。接线图如下图所示: 电源接线没什么好说的,主要是串口这边,一定要注意交叉接线,也就是 CH340 转 TLL 工具的 TX 要接板子的 RX ,CH340...
ISP下载程序 ISP下载用的上位机软件是FlyMcu,通过该软件可以ISP下载程序、擦除芯片,还可以读芯片的信息。设置BOOT ISP下载时,IK-ZET6开发板上的BOOT引脚需要按照下图所示设置,即BT0=0,BT1=0。图1:开发板BOOT设置 配置ISP下载软件 电脑上双击打开FlyMcu软件,进入如下界面,并按步骤配置好。图2:配置ISP下载...
STM32的ISP下载程序方式:1、STM32的板子的串口ISP下载方法:Boot0接到3.3V上,Boot1接到GND,对板子重新上电,STM32单片机重启的时候,会进入到ISP模式。2、硬件连接:首先要有一个USB转TTL串口板子,或者STM32的板载上有USB转TTL串口模块。USB转TTL板子的TXD与STM32的RXD1连接。USB转TTL板子RXD与和STM32的TXD1连接...
ISP方式下载程序原理 ISP:In System Programing,在系统中编程 在STM32F10xxx里有三种启动方式: 以ISP方式下载程序时需要把STM32的BOOT0引脚置1、BOOT1引脚置0,即从系统存储区(System Memory)启动。为什么设置从System Memory启动就可以使用串口来下载我们的程序呢?那是因为在芯片出厂前ST官方已经把一段自举程序(Boot...
微处理器STM32F103ZET6(以下简称为ZET6)是通过串口1进行ISP下载的,ISP下载时,芯片必须进入ISP模式。ZET6是通过设置BOOT0和BOOT1这两个引脚的电平来确定启动模式的,BOOT0和BOOT1引脚在芯片复位时的电平决定了芯片从哪个区域开始执行程序,如下表所示。由此可见ISP下载时,需要设置BOOT1=0,BOOT0=1,这样芯片复位后即...
mcuisp stm32是一款非常便捷易用的单片机编程软件,mcuisp stm32可以帮助用户解决stm32f系列单片机和NXP的LPC2xxx系列的isp问题,能够下载一段代码到SRAM里面,再利用我自定的协议进行真正的FLASH烧录,可以超脱STM32自身串口ISP的某些局限性,非常的方便实用。